Position title: Victim Witness Specialist I
Position summary and duties:
This position is a liaison between the attorney and the victims/witnesses involved in criminal cases prosecuted by the State Attorney's Office and is responsible for a wide variety of office duties including but not limited to: communicating case related information with victims and witnesses, coordinating trials, maintaining accurate data entry and addressing any attorney requests. Applicants should possess knowledge of legal terminology and be able to communicate clearly and concisely both verbally and in writing. An applicant must be detail oriented and able to prioritize tasks, work under pressure and adapt to changing situations as well as exhibit a willingness to perform other tasks as assigned. The successful candidate will be ready to work as part of a team and also be capable of independent judgment.

Minimum Requirements :
Education: A high school diploma or equivalency and experience in the area of criminal justice, social science, counseling, public contact or customer service; or an equivalent combination of training and experience. Bachelor’s degree may be substituted for required experience.
Additionally, applicants must possess a valid Florida driver’s license and demonstrate the ability to type and enter data accurately.
Physical Demands :
This position requires normal pushing, lifting and moving of boxes and files up to 25 lbs.
